Medal Of Honor in Sentence Examples

1. The Medal of Honor is the highest accolade a soldier can win.

2. The Medal of Honor is rarely awarded to someone that did not engage in supererogatory bravery.

3. The Medal of Honor recipient was so excited that he began to weep tears of joy while standing on stage.

4. The president will present the country’s Highest Medal of Honor to the soldier who showed indomitable bravery by going behind enemy lines to save his commanding officer.

5. Jeff was given a medal of honor in recognition of the twenty-five years he spent fighting for his country.
